在Ruby on Rails中,可以通过使用CSS样式来清除HTML元素的模板。以下是正确应用CSS样式于HTML元素清除模板的步骤:
- 创建一个CSS文件:首先,在Rails应用程序的"app/assets/stylesheets"目录下创建一个新的CSS文件,例如"reset.css"。
- 清除HTML元素样式:在"reset.css"文件中,使用CSS选择器来清除HTML元素的默认样式。可以通过设置元素的属性,例如"margin"、"padding"、"border"等,将它们重置为零,或者通过设置"font"、"color"等属性将它们重置为默认值。例如,可以使用以下代码来清除所有元素的默认外边距和内边距:
- 清除HTML元素样式:在"reset.css"文件中,使用CSS选择器来清除HTML元素的默认样式。可以通过设置元素的属性,例如"margin"、"padding"、"border"等,将它们重置为零,或者通过设置"font"、"color"等属性将它们重置为默认值。例如,可以使用以下代码来清除所有元素的默认外边距和内边距:
- 这将把所有元素的外边距和内边距重置为零。
- 将CSS文件应用于HTML模板:要在HTML模板中使用这个CSS文件,可以在Rails应用程序的布局文件(通常是"app/views/layouts/application.html.erb")中引入它。在文件的头部添加以下代码:
- 将CSS文件应用于HTML模板:要在HTML模板中使用这个CSS文件,可以在Rails应用程序的布局文件(通常是"app/views/layouts/application.html.erb")中引入它。在文件的头部添加以下代码:
- 这将在HTML模板中引入名为"reset.css"的CSS文件。
以上是在Ruby on Rails中正确应用CSS样式于HTML元素清除模板的步骤。这样做的优势是可以确保HTML元素在各个浏览器中具有一致的默认样式,并且在开发过程中避免了不必要的样式冲突。
腾讯云提供的与此相关的产品是腾讯云Web应用防火墙(WAF)。它是一项网络安全服务,可以保护网站免受常见的网络攻击,包括CSS注入、跨站脚本攻击(XSS)等。您可以通过访问以下链接获取腾讯云Web应用防火墙的详细信息和产品介绍:https://cloud.tencent.com/product/waf